摘 要:为明确准噶尔盆地油气运聚演化特征,以准噶尔盆地南北向挤压大剖面为研究对象,基于PetroMod软件先进的"Block"功能,采用附集法对剖面进行了烃源岩成熟度与油气运聚模拟,在剖面上充分考虑了快速沉积、异常超压、挤压逆冲及剥蚀作用等对烃源岩热演化历史的影响。结果表明,准噶尔盆地二叠系烃源岩在侏罗纪进入成熟阶段,现今热演化程度处于高成熟-过成熟阶段,侏罗系烃源岩在古近纪至第四纪进入成熟阶段;盆地的昌吉凹陷及玛湖凹陷等地区发育侏罗系和下二叠统为中心的两套超压系统;并揭示了准噶尔盆地油气自早侏罗世开始运移,至白垩纪达到高效运移阶段,主要聚集在构造高点及断裂带附近。该认识对准噶尔盆地成藏过程具有重要意义。In order to clarity the oil and gas migration and accumulation evolution characteristics of Junggar Basin,the large compression profile of S-N in Junggar Basin was taken as the object of study,Based on the advanced Block function of PetroMod software,the maturity of hydrocarbon source rock and hydrocarbon migration and accumulation were simulated by the method of appended set.In the section the effects of overlapping action,overpressure,rapid deposition or denudation on the history of hydrocarbon rocks were fully considered.The results show that the Permian hydrocarbon source rocks in Junggar Basin enters into the mature stage of hydrocarbon generation and now is at the mature stage,Jurassic source rocks are entered in maturity stage from Paleogene to Quaternary,in the areas of Changji Depression and Mahu Depression,2 sets of overpressure systems are developed based on Jurassic and Lower Permian,which indicates that oil and gas start migration from early Jurassic,to the Cretaceous period,the high efficient migration stage is started,oil and gas are accumulated on the Tectonic high point and near fault zone,this understanding is of great significance in the process of reservoir formation in Junggar Basin.
